Government Unveils Demand-Driven TVET Reforms to Boost Youth Employability

The Deputy Minister of Technical and Higher Education, Sarjoh Aziz-Kamara, has reaffirmed the Government of Sierra Leone’s commitment to overhauling Technical and Vocational Education and Training (TVET), stating that ongoing reforms are designed to equip young people with industry-relevant skills and strengthen the country’s workforce.
